Sunteți pe pagina 1din 5

Ministerul Educaiei al Republicii Moldova

Universitatea Tehnic a Moldovei

Catedra: Automatic i Tehnologii Informaionale

RAPORT
Lucrare de laborator Nr.4
la disciplina Analiza i modelarea sistemelor informaionale
Tema: Diagrama de secven

A efectuat:
st. gr. SI-121

Stratan Dumitru

A verificat:
lect. sup.

Radu Melnic
Nina Sava

Chiinu 2015

Scopul lucrrii: Crearea diagramelor de secven pentru un sistem de pariuri online .


Mersul lucrrii:
Modelarea vizual n UML poate fi reprezentat ca un oarecare proces de lansare pe
niveluri de la cel mai general i abstract model conceptual al sistemului iniial ctre modelul
logic i mai apoi fizic, ce corespunde unui sistem de program. Pentru atingerea acestui scop de
la nceput se creaz un model n form de diagarama cazurilor de utilizare (use case diagram)
care descrie destinaia functional a sistemului sau cu alte cuvinte descrie ceea ce sistemul va
executa n procesul su de funcionare. Diagrama cazurilor de utilizare reprezint un model
iniial conceptual al unui sistem n procesul de proiectare i exploatare.
Esena acestei diagrame const n faptul c: sistemul proiectat se reprezint ca o colecie de
entiti i actori care colaboreaz cu sistemul cu ajutorul aa numitor cazuri de utilizare.
Totodat orice entitate care colaboreaz cu sistemul din afar poate fi numit actor. Aceasta
poate fi un om, o instalare tehnic, un program sau oricare alt sistem care poate fi surs de
aciune pentru sistemul proiectat n aa mod, cum l determin colaboratorul. La rndul su,
use case-ul este creat pentru descrierea serviciilor pe care sistemul le ofer actorului. Cu alte
cuvinte fiecare caz de utilizare definete o colecie de aciuni executate de sistem n timpul
dialogului cu actorul. Totodat nimic nu este spus despre aceea n ce mod va fi realizat
colaborare ntre actori i sistem.
1. Diagrama de secven corespunztoare autentificrii n sistem:

Fig.1 - Diagrama de secven corespunztoare procesului de autentificare n sistem


Diagrama dat include actorul User care se autentific n sistem el introduce datele care se
proceseaz de un procesor de verificare a datelor apoi se verifica cu baza de date a bancii i

dac parola este valid se trasmite la procesorul de verificare a datelor apoi spre interfa a
grafic

2. Diagrama de secven corespunztoare procesului de extragere a numerarului

Fig.2 - Diagrama de secven corespunztoare procesului de extragere a numerarului


Diagrama dat include actorul User, care dorete s extrag numerar , aici datele de la
utilizator sunt transmise catre interfaa grafic apoi ea le transmite care baza de date a bancii
unde datele se proceseaz si vine rspunsul .

3. Diagrama de secven corespunztoare procesului de modificare a pinului :

Fig.3 - Diagrama de secven corespunztoare procesului de modificare a pinului


Diagrama dat include actorul User care modific codul pin unde datele se introduc de ctre
user apoi aceste date se verific de procesorul de verificare a datelor apoi se compar cu cel
care este introdus in Baza de date banc si dac este validat vine rspunsul

4. Diagrama de secven corespunztoare procesului de vizualizare a soldului:

Fig4. Diagrama de secven corespunztoare procesului de vizualizare a soldului

Concluzie:
n urma efecturii acestei lucrri de laborator am studiat diagramele
de secven pentru un sistem software a unui bancomat. Am descris modul n
care este efectuat procedura de autentificare, extragere a numerarului , de
modificare a pinului si de vizualizare a strii contului.